Patna: Two persons were injured in a brazen shooting incident that took place on Monday night on Bakhtiyarpur-Harnaut road under Bakhtiyarpur police station area in Patna district. Unidentified assailants on a motorcycle opened fire on them near a petrol pump in Madhopur village.The injured were identified as Saina Kumar, son of Sunil Kumar, a resident of Madhopur, and Prakash Kumar, son of Rudal Yadav, a resident of Birpur in Vaishali district.According to police, the attackers, who had their faces covered, arrived on a motorcycle and suddenly targeted Saina, firing multiple shots. Three bullets hit him in the chest. Prakash, who was present nearby, also sustained a bullet injury in the shoulder.After the attack, the criminals fled from the spot. Local residents admitted both the injured youths to the Community Health Centre in Bakhtiyarpur. Given the seriousness of their injuries, doctors provided first aid and referred them to the PMCH for advanced treatment.Upon receiving information about the incident, Bakhtiyarpur SHO Devanand Sharma reached the hospital along with a police team to gather details. Police have cordoned off the area and launched raids to identify and arrest the accused. CCTV footage from nearby cameras is also being scanned for vital clues.Kundan Kumar, Patna SP (Rural), said the FSL team was called to the spot to gather evidence, and three empty shells were recovered from the crime spot. “Police are investigating the case from all angles,” he added.
